kiba-engine
Data Structures
Here are the data structures with brief descriptions:
C
allocator
Central allocator structure
C
allocator_impl
Structure holding a specific allocator type's implementation
C
array_header
C
event_context
Context used to store data of an event
C
event_system_state
C
file_handle
Handle for a file
C
float_cast
C
format_buffer
C
format_options
C
free_list_allocator_block
Internal state of the free_list_allocator
C
free_list_entry
A single entry of a free list
C
gpu_backend_buffer
C
gpu_backend_command_encoder
C
gpu_backend_device
C
gpu_backend_pipeline
C
gpu_backend_pipeline_layout
C
gpu_backend_shader_module
C
gpu_backend_surface
C
gpu_backend_texture
C
gpu_backend_texture_view
C
gpu_bind_group_descriptor
C
gpu_bind_group_entry
C
gpu_bind_group_layout_descriptor
C
gpu_bind_group_layout_entry
C
gpu_binding_type_buffer
C
gpu_binding_type_sampler
C
gpu_binding_type_storage_texture
C
gpu_binding_type_texture
C
gpu_blend_state
C
gpu_buffer
C
gpu_buffer_barrier
C
gpu_buffer_descriptor
C
gpu_buffer_tracker
C
gpu_color
C
gpu_color_attachment
C
gpu_color_target_state
C
gpu_command_encoder
C
gpu_command_encoder_descriptor
C
gpu_depth_stencil_attachment
C
gpu_depth_stencil_state
C
gpu_device
C
gpu_device_resource
C
gpu_extent_3d
C
gpu_fragment_state
C
gpu_operations
C
gpu_pipeline
C
gpu_pipeline_layout
C
gpu_pipeline_layout_descriptor
C
gpu_primitive_state
C
gpu_queued_resource_destructions
C
gpu_render_pass_descriptor
C
gpu_render_pipeline_descriptor
C
gpu_sampler_descriptor
C
gpu_shader_module
C
gpu_shader_module_descriptor
C
gpu_surface
C
gpu_surface_configuration
C
gpu_texture
C
gpu_texture_barrier
C
gpu_texture_descriptor
C
gpu_texture_tracker
C
gpu_texture_view
C
gpu_texture_view_descriptor
C
gpu_vertex_buffer_layout
C
gpu_vertex_buffer_layout_attribute
C
gpu_vertex_state
C
hash_table
C
hash_table_entry
C
input_state
State of the input system
C
kb_error
C
kb_id_generator
C
linear_allocator_block
Internal state of the linear_allocator
C
linux_window_state
C
mat4
C
memory_page
C
platform_window
Structure holding information about a window
C
registered_listener
C
registered_listener_list
C
string
Structure for a string
C
string_view
Non owning views on actual strings
C
timestamp
C
uniform_buffer_object
C
vec3
C
vec4
C
vk_alloc
C
vk_attachment_key
C
vk_color_attachment_key
C
vk_depth_stencil_attachment_key
C
vk_device_requirements
C
vk_framebuffer
C
vk_framebuffer_attachment
C
vk_framebuffer_key
C
vk_instance_requirements
C
vk_instance_t
C
vk_queue
C
vk_renderpass
C
vk_renderpass_key
C
vulkan_allocator
C
vulkan_buffer
C
vulkan_context
C
vulkan_device
C
vulkan_device_requirements
C
vulkan_image
C
vulkan_instance
C
vulkan_pipeline
C
vulkan_queue
C
vulkan_swap_chain
C
vulkan_swap_chain_requirements
C
vulkan_sync
C
vulkan_vertex
Generated by
1.9.1